Summary:Domestic and international experiments using WINDS under the guidance of ARIB are introduced. Super-Hivision signal transmission experiment was carried out in May 2009 under the collaboration between NICT and NHK. In this experiment Super-Hivision signal is transmitted from Sapporo to Tokyo using WINDS. The Ku- and Ka-band satellite signals reception system for Earth-space path attenuation characteristics analysis at Tokyo Metropolitan University (TMU) is shown. In this system, WINDS TDMA signal is received with very short time period using by measuring each TDMA slot signal levels.
